What do you like about your job and the company?

Engaging with many more universities with regard to partnership. Planning and coordinating event on and off campus. The role enables my interaction with universities' Management team; Vice Chancellor, Deputy Vice Chancellor, deans, and lecturers. In this role, I learn how to plan a program from scratch, executing them and finding solutions to unforeseen circumstances.

The most important thing I have learned in my career by far, is to be open-minded and have a growth mindset. When I first started as a data science engineer, I was obsessed with the idea that I need to be working on those fancy ideas that allows me to apply the cutting-edge data science technologies, and I would be demotivated when assigned to other tasks like data engineering. Gradually, I found that actually all my experiences, no matter how big or small, will make me unique and become useful at some point in time. For example, if I did not have hands-on experiences on the data engineering tasks in the beginning, I would not be able to lead my team and give them good guidance. So my top advice is to be open, positive, and embrace the growth mindset!
